From: Doug Oucharek Date: Sun, 18 Sep 2016 20:39:02 +0000 (-0400) Subject: staging: lustre: o2iblnd: Put back work queue check previously removed X-Git-Tag: v4.9-rc1~119^2~380 X-Git-Url: https://git.karo-electronics.de/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=d566b9aec93e603f59430d32d7996b74a7b5f555;p=karo-tx-linux.git staging: lustre: o2iblnd: Put back work queue check previously removed The previous patch, http://review.whamcloud.com/21304/, removed a check needed until LU-5718 is properly addressed. With the check, LU-5718 results in an error message and a lost RDMA operation. Without it, we have memory corruption and a crash (much harder to debug). Putting the check back in case LU-5718 is not fixed soon.
